is a stone structure embedded with human skulls located in , . It was constructed by the Ottoman Empire following the Battle of Čegar of May 1809, during the First Serbian Uprising. is situated 3 km northeast of Турски шанчеви.

is a multi-purpose stadium in , . It is used mostly for football matches and is the home ground of Radnički Niš. After a partial reconstruction that began in 2011, the renovated stadium re-opened to the public on 15 September 2012. is situated 3 km north of Турски шанчеви.
